Action Statement Flora and Fauna Guarantee Act 1998 No. 2 31 Wellington Mint-bush Prosthanthera galbraithiae This Action Statement is based on a draft Recovery Plan prepared for this species by DSE under contract to the Australian Government Department of the Environment, Water, Heritage and the Arts. Description Wellington Mint-bush (Prostanthera galbraithiae ) is an erect or spreading shrub, 0.3–2 m tall (Walsh & Entwisle 1999). Young branches have a square- shaped cross-section, and are densely hairy between two faint lateral-running ridges and on nodes; the rest of the branch is hairless (Walsh & Entwisle 1999). The leaves are stalkless, arise in opposite pairs and have a slight aroma when crushed (Walsh & Entwisle 1999). They are linear, narrowly ovate or oblong, ~15 x 2 mm, mid green and mostly hairless (Walsh & Entwisle 1999). Flowers appear from September through to November, and are generally deep mauve to purple with deep mauve to purple spots in the throat. Distribution in Victoria The two upper petals form a hood and the three (Flora Information System DSE 2007) lower petals form a fan shape. The petals are 7 - 10 mm long; the middle petal of the lower three, however, is broader and longer than each of the two upper petals (Walsh & Entwisle 1999). The stamens have anthers which lack a basal appendage. The surrounding calyx is divided into two lips, the upper lip (curved backwards) grows to 5.5 mm in length. Eight to 24 flowers appear in a leafy, branched inflorescence that may be branched or unbranched. ISBN 0 7313 68894 Approved Recovery Plan Boronia granitica Executive Summary Introduction Boronia granitica (Granite Boronia) is a medium-sized, open shrub with pinnate foliage and pink flowers. It grows in heathy vegetation amongst granite boulders of the New England Batholith, where it is restricted to a limited number of mostly small populations. Papers and Proceedings of the Royal Society of Tasmania, Volume 131, 1997 37 THE VEGETATION AND FLORA OF THREE HUMMOCK ISLAND, WESTERN BASS STRAIT by Stephen Harris and Jayne Balmer (with one table, four text-figures, nine plates and an appendix) HARRIS, S. & BALMER, ]., 1997 (31 :viii): The vegetation and flora of Three Hummock Island, western Bass Strait. Pap. Proc. R. Soc. Tasm. 131: 37-56. ISSN 0800-4703. Parks and Wildlife Service, Department of Environment and Land Management, GPO Box 44A, Hobart, Tasmania, Australia 7001. A survey of the vegetation of Three Hummock Island Nature Reserve recorded 289 vascular higher plant species, 60 of which were introduced. Of the native flora, six are classified as rare or vulnerable. Clarke Island, at a similar latitude in Eastern Bass Strait, has a significantly richer flora, including an element of Mainland Australian/Bassian flora for which the island is the southernmost limit. In contrast, there are no species known from Three Hummock Island that do not occur on mainland Tasmania. The greater length of time during which the land bridge at the eastern end of Bass Strait was exposed is, therefore, reflected in the flora. Three Hummock Island was cut off for a much longer period with no land connections to the north, therefore has a more insular Tasmanian flora. Climatic differences may have exacerbated the contrast. Nine vegetation mapping communities are defined, the largest proportion of the island being covered by Myrtaceae-dominated scrub. The main changes in the vegetation since the time of European discovery have been the clearing of much of the relatively fertile calcareous sands for grazing and the consequent loss of most of the Eucalyptus viminalis forests, an increased fire frequency and the introduction of exotic plants. -

Castlemaine Naturalist November 2016 Vol. 41.10 #448 Monthly newsletter of the Castlemaine Field Naturalists Club Inc. Australasian Gannet - photo Joy Weatherill Mud Islands, South Channel Fort and Pope's Eye Joy Weatherill On 25th September, I went with Geelong Field Naturalists Club to Mud Islands, an exposed area of the Great Sands, and the most extensive sandbank in Port Phillip Bay, 90 kilometres south west of Melbourne and 10 kilometres inside Port Phillip Heads. It is a land area of about 50 hectares surrounding a shallow tidal lagoon of 35 hectares. The shapes and configuration of the islands change due to movements of the sands by tidal currents, so at present, there are 2 land masses - Boatswain Island and East Island, and a North and South Outlet into the Tidal Lagoon. We were taken by boat from Queenscliff and dropped off on East Island, from where we walked around to South Outlet. Memories from my one previous visit about 25 years ago were having to wade ashore, and of thousands of screaming Silver Gulls. We walked straight onto the beach down a ramp, but there were still thousands of screaming gulls. Understandably they were upset, because there were many nests still with unhatched eggs and some new chicks. The nests are extremely rudimentary - a slight depression in the sand and a small amount of vegetation ( a couple of sticks!). We walked away from what seemed to be the main Silver Gull nesting area. There were also many Straw-necked Ibis and some White Ibis further inland among the salt bushes. -

Native gardens are water efficient, conserve native plants, support wildlife and contribute to a greener surburban environment. With a long history of adapting to local soils and climatic conditions, native plants are well placed to cope with future localised changes in climate and seasonality.
